Default My daughter is moving to Stockton

The good news...my 21-year old daughter just landed her dream job.

The bad news...she's relocating 2,300 miles away to Stockton.

I've read a lot of bad things about Stockton; however I also read there are some good things about it. She'll be starting out at about $44K a year, so she should be able to find a decent apartment in a good area of town.

My questions...

1) What's the best areas for housing? She'll be working at the airport. I'm thinking maybe near your university...or possibly Lodi, a few miles away.

2) How's the nightlife for a young, single woman? Again, I'm thinking near your university.

3) Are there any country music radio stations within range? I checked Wikipedia, and it does not seem as if you have any. My daugher loves country, and has all her car radio presets to the country stations. (We have at least five country stations in the Cincinnati area.)

4) Anything else we should know?

I don't know much about Stockton, but I was looking at the 95129 area a couple years back when the foreclosures were just beginning to rain down. It seemed like a nice, quiet little area and there were some nicely decked out condos on W Benjamin Holt Dr. I was looking in that area because I have a policy, which has served me well for years, to check out automobile insurance rates for all the ZIP codes wherever I moved and pick out the lowest I could afford (because it's an indicator of lower property crime).

95202 $843
95203 $873
95204 $873
95205 $1,074
95206 $869
95207 $890
95209 $866
95210 $1,123
95211 $822
95212 $949
95215 $930
95219 $818

Stockton Metropolitan Airport is on the south side bordering French Camp and Manteca, so..

1) 6 mi
2) 19 mi
